Phone number ☎️ 01793540857 👆 is reported as a persistent scam number impersonating major UK mobile providers such as O2, EE, and Vodafone. Callers often claim to offer discounted bills or special deals, frequently following a suspicious text with a verification code. Recipients report silent calls, hang-ups when questioned, or pressure to share security information. Many users advise against answering or providing any personal details, emphasising the risk of fraud. The number is widely flagged as spam, with multiple reports of blocked calls and warnings urging caution. It is strongly recommended to avoid engagement and report or block the number to prevent potential scams or identity theft.

About 01 Numbers
These numbers are connected to specific locations in the UK and are often utilized by homes and businesses. Also known as as 'basic rate', 'local rate', or 'national rate' numbers, the charges for these geographic numbers are predicated on the time of day. Numerous service providers offer call packages that offer free calls during designated times. Call costs from mobile phones are according to the chosen calling plan, with many plans incorporating these numbers in their free call packages.
